Professional Experience

Bob is an associate in the Business Litigation practice group. He focuses his practice on representing financial institutions, charitable organizations and corporations in consumer finance, commercial and business litigation matters, including matters concerning fiduciary duties, creditors' rights, lender liability, pharmaceuticals, mass tort and toxic tort and tax controversies, at the class action, appellate and trial levels. Bob routinely defends financial institutions from common law claims and those arising under Ohio's Uniform Commercial Code, the Truth in Lending Act, the Real Estate Settlement Procedures Act, the Fair Debt Collection Practices Act and the Ohio Consumer Sales Practices Act. Bob has represented several major national and international financial and charitable institutions and foundations in litigation matters.

Bob is a member of the firm's Diversity Committee and LGBT Taskforce.

Bob is actively involved in the firm's pro bono work.

Bob is admitted to practice in the State of Ohio, the Northern District of Ohio and the Sixth Circuit.
